> > Upgraded to breezy a few days ago---and discovered Totem won't play
> > a lot of files. So I installed the W32codecs from the mplayer
> > site...and gs-streamer but Totem is still uncooperative. Won't play
> > avi's or wmv's.
> >
> > Ran gs-register (I think that was the name) and it seemed to find
> > all the plugins. And where is the place in Totem where you add
> > plugins?
>
> GStreamer won't use W32codecs out of the box, it needs the pitfdll
> plugin installed. The easiest way to do this, is to install the
> package "gstreamer0.8-plugins-multiverse" (which is in multiverse).
>
> For me, having gstreamer0.8-plugins-multiverse and
> gstreamer0.8-plugins installed makes gstreamer work with most media.
Thats strange because I had the pitfdll plugin package installed. Then I
got the W32codecs and ran gs-register (which is actually called
gs-register-0.8) and it found the plugins. But Totem still wouldn't play
AVI's or WMV's. Totem-xine works fine however.
